Historical & Cultural Background

The name Jonbenet is a modern combination of the name John and the French diminutive suffix '-et'. It gained notoriety due to the tragic case of JonBenét Ramsey, a young girl whose murder in 1996 received widespread media attention. The name reflects a blend of cultural influences, particularly from English and French traditions.
